Arm Lift
Brachioplasty

An upper arm lift, is a surgical procedure that reshapes the under portion of the upper arm to reduce excess sagging underarm skin, remove fat and tighten the appearance of the upper arm.

The surgeon makes an incision from the elbow to the armpit, underlying tissue and fat are removed, and the remaining skin and tissue are lifted to achieve a tighter and smoother effect.

Recovery

You will go home a day or so after your arm lift surgery. Upper arm lift recovery times are one to two weeks. Therefore, you can return to work after about two weeks and to the gym after four to six weeks.

Swelling and redness usually disappears after a month and numbness may last for a few months. Any drains and stitches are removed after five to 10 days and a surgical stocking will need to be worn for three to four weeks.

Results

The smoother tighter contours of your arms will be apparent almost immediately after your procedure. There will be some swelling and bruising. Your arm life will leave you with a permanent visible scar and It may take up to two years to see the final results.
